A fajita chicken marinade is a flavorful mixture. It is designed to enhance the taste and tenderness of chicken. This makes it ideal for fajitas. Typically, the marinade combines several key ingredients that create a zesty and savory profile.

Ingredients:

  • Citrus Juice: Fresh lime or lemon juice is commonly used for acidity, which helps tenderize the chicken and adds brightness.
  • Oil: Olive oil or vegetable oil provides moisture and helps the flavors adhere to the chicken.
  • Spices: Cumin, paprika, chili powder, and garlic powder are often included to give a robust and slightly smoky flavor.
  • Herbs: Fresh or dried cilantro can add a refreshing herbal note.
  • Salt and Pepper: Essential for seasoning and enhancing the overall taste.

The marinade typically boasts a balance of flavors. It has tanginess from the citrus. There is warmth from the spices and richness from the oil. It creates a deliciously seasoned chicken. This chicken can be grilled, sautéed, or baked. It’s perfect for serving in flour or corn tortillas with sautéed bell peppers and onions.

To use the marinade, combine all the ingredients. Toss in the chicken (usually breast or thighs). Let it marinate for at least 30 minutes to a few hours. For deeper flavor, marinate it overnight. Cook the marinated chicken to perfection. This results in juicy, flavorful meat. It’s ready for assembly into individual fajitas.

Grilling Fajita Chicken Marinade

Grilling fajita chicken is a fantastic way to infuse that smoky flavor while keeping the meat juicy and tender. Here’s how to grill the marinated curry chicken to perfection:

  1. Preheat the Grill: Preheat your grill to medium-high heat (about 375°F to 400°F or 190°C to 200°C). Make sure the grates are clean.
  2. Prepare the Chicken: Remove the marinated chicken from the Ziploc bag, allowing any excess marinade to drip off. If desired, you can brush the chicken lightly with olive oil to prevent sticking and add flavor.
  3. Grill the Chicken: Grill for about 5-7 minutes on each side. Make sure the chicken is cooked through. Check that the chicken reaches the safe internal temperature.
  4. Create Grill Marks: Avoid flipping the chicken too often. Let it sear for a few minutes on each side to develop nice grill marks.
  5. Optional Glazing: Brush the chicken with any remaining marinade during the last couple of minutes of cooking. Make sure the marinade has been cooked. This step adds extra flavor.
  6. Rest: Once cooked, remove the chicken from the grill and let it rest for about 5 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ute and keeps the meat moist.
  7. Serve: Garnish with fresh herbs like cilantro or basil and serve with sides like rice, naan, or a refreshing salad. Enjoy the smokey, spiced flavor of your grilled Fajita chicken!

Tips for Perfectly Grilled Fajita Chicken

  • Temperature Control: Keep an eye on the grill temperature. Too high can cause the marinade to burn before the chicken cooks through.
  • Marinate Longer: For even deeper flavor, marinate the chicken overnight.
  • Use a Meat Thermometer: This ensures you cook the chicken to the perfect internal temperature.

Baking Fajita Chicken Marinade

Baking fajita chicken is an excellent way to achieve tender, flavorful meat while keeping the cooking process simple and hands-off. Here’s how to bake your marinated curry chicken to perfection:

  1.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). This temperature ensures the chicken cooks evenly while allowing the marinade to caramelize slightly.
  2. Prepare the Baking Dish: Lightly grease a baking dish with olive oil to prevent sticking.
  3. Arrange the Chicken: Take the marinated chicken out of the Ziploc bag. Place the pieces in a single layer in the prepared baking dish. You can brush a little olive oil over the top of the chicken. This adds moisture and flavor.
  4. Bake the Chicken: Place the baking dish in the preheated oven. Bake for 25 – 35 minutes. The exact baking time depends on the size and thickness of the chicken pieces. Chicken breasts typically take about 25 – 30 minutes.
  5. Check for Doneness: The chicken is done when it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). You can use a meat thermometer to confirm accuracy. The juices should run clear, and there should be no pink in the center.
  6. Broil for Extra Color (Optional): Switch the oven to the broil setting. This will give the chicken a nice golden color. Do this for the last 3-5 minutes of cooking. Keep a close watch to prevent burning.
  7. Rest: Once baked, remove the chicken from the oven and let it rest for about 5 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ute, keeping the meat moist.
  8. Serve: Garnish with fresh herbs like cilantro or parsley before serving. Enjoy with rice, naan, or a fresh salad.

Tips for Perfectly Baked Fajita Chicken

  • Even Cooking: If using different cuts of chicken, try to use pieces of similar size to ensure even cooking.
  • Add Vegetables: Add vegetables like bell peppers, onions, or zucchini to the baking dish. Roast them alongside the chicken for a full meal.
  • Cover If Necessary: If you notice the chicken browning too quickly, cover the dish loosely with aluminum foil. This will allow it to cook through without burning.

Sautéing Fajita Chicken Marinade

Sautéing is a quick and flavorful method for cooking fajita chicken. It allows the spices to bloom. This method ensures the spices fully infuse the meat. Here’s how to sauté your marinated fajita chicken for a delicious meal:

  1. Heat the Pan: In a large skillet or sauté pan, heat the oil over medium-high heat. Make sure the oil is hot but not smoking.
  2. Add Aromatics (Optional): If using onions or bell peppers, add them to the pan. Sauté for about 2-3 minutes until they start to soften. They will become fragrant.
  3. Sauté the Chicken: Remove the marinated chicken from the Ziploc bag, allowing any excess marinade to drip off. Add the chicken pieces to the hot skillet in a single layer, leaving enough space between pieces for even cooking. You need to do this in batches if your skillet is not large enough.
  4. Cook the Chicken: Sauté the chicken for about 5-7 minutes. Stir occasionally. Continue until the chicken is cooked through and nicely browned. If the chicken pieces are thick, reduce the heat to medium. Cover the pan to allow the insides to cook through. This prevents burning the outsides.
  5. Check for Doneness: Make sure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). The juices should run clear, and there should be no pink in the center.
  6. Finish Cooking: If desired, add a splash of coconut milk. You can also use some water to deglaze the pan. This will create a sauce. Scrape any browned bits from the bottom of the pan to enhance flavor. Let it simmer for an extra minute or two.
  7. Serve: Remove the skillet from heat and garnish with fresh herbs like cilantro or parsley. Serve your sautéed fajita chicken with rice, naan, or vegetables for a full meal.

Tips for Perfectly Sautéed Fajita Chicken

  • Uniform Pieces: Cut the chicken into uniform pieces for even cooking. This will help to avoid some pieces being overcooked while others are still under cooked.
  •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: If the pan is too crowded, the chicken will steam rather than sauté. Work in batches if necessary.
  • Adjust Seasoning: Taste the dish before serving. You want to add a pinch of salt. Consider adding extra spices depending on your preference.

Air Frying Fajita Chicken Marinade

Air frying fajita chicken is a quick and efficient method that yields juicy, flavorful results with a crispy exterior. Here’s how to prepare your marinated curry chicken in the air fryer:

  1. Preheat the Air Fryer: Preheat your air fryer to 390°F (190°C) for about 3-5 minutes.
  2. Prepare the Chicken: Remove the marinated chicken from the Ziploc bag, allowing any excess marinade to drip off. If desired, you can lightly spray the chicken pieces with olive oil for a crispier texture.
  3. Arrange in the Air Fryer Basket: Place the chicken in the air fryer basket in a single layer. Make sure not to overcrowd. If necessary, cook in batches to guarantee proper airflow and even cooking.
  4. Air Fry the Chicken:
    • Cook the chicken for about 15 – 20 minutes, flipping halfway through. Cooking time vary depending on the size and thickness of the chicken pieces.
    • For chicken breasts, check for doneness around the 15 -minute mark.
  5. Check for Doneness: The chicken is done when it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). Use a meat thermometer to guarantee accuracy. The exterior should be nicely browned and crispy.
  6. Rest: Once cooked, remove the chicken from the air fryer. Let it rest for about 5 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ute.
  7. Serve: Garnish with fresh herbs like cilantro or parsley before serving. Enjoy your air-fried Fajita chicken with rice, naan, or your favorite side.

Tips for Perfectly Air-Fried Fajita Chicken

  • Prevent Sticking: If your air fryer basket is prone to sticking, use parchment paper designed for air fryers. Alternatively, spray it lightly with oil.
  • Adjust Cooking Time: Adjust the cooking time based on the size and thickness of the chicken pieces. Always start checking for doneness a few minutes early to avoid overcooking.
  • Experiment with Temperature: If you like a more intense char, increase the temperature to 400°F (200°C). Do this for the last few minutes of cooking.

Notes

This marinade makes ⅜ cup or 6 tablespoons of marinade for each 1 pound of chicken.

To grill whole chicken breasts effectively, flatten them. This ensures quick and even cooking. Place your chicken breasts between two sheets of plastic cling film. Pound them with a meat mallet or tenderizer ( the flat side ). Start at the center of the chicken breast and work your way toward the edges.
